UC IRVINE EXTENSION LAUNCHES NEW STRATEGIC LEADERSHIP DEVELOPMENT CERTIFICATE PROGRAM

By Loan Vo (LEGACY) posted 08-11-2014 06:24 PM

  

For the fall 2014 quarter, the University of California, Irvine Extension is launching a new Strategic Leadership Development Certificate Program for professionals seeking leadership skills essential to being an effective executive, manager, supervisor, or team member in any field or industry. This program is offered in a new delivery format, Direct Assessment, which places emphasis on the quality of work done on multiple online projects. UC Irvine Extension sets the precedent for being one of the first institutions to utilize this format in continuing education. Rather than spending time inside the classroom taking courses, participants will be completing five Learning Projects and collaborating with mentors on an as needed basis.

            “The new Strategic Leadership Development Certificate Program is an innovative approach to learning as it allows professionals to expand their skill set at their own pace. Through our Direct Assessment method, participants have the ability to earn a certificate in as little as one quarter,” said Tom Pokladowski, director of law & finance programs at UC Irvine Extension. “This program is unique because it was designed for those who want to learn new leadership skills and those who want credit for demonstrating competency at leadership skills they’ve already acquired.”

The curriculum includes the following five learning project topics:

  • Principles of Leadership – Participants will examine the elements of leadership that have proven effective across roles and industries, and learn to define the difference between management and leadership.
  • Creating the Strategic Vision – Material will focus on the difference between a vision, mission and strategy, and participants will learn about critical thinking and idea generation to support goal setting.
  • Influencing Others – In order for leaders to effectively communicate with other leaders, colleagues, and partners, they must learn multiple ways to communicate and persuade others as well as understand the concepts of influence and problem solving.
  • Leading Others – Participants will gain insight into different ways to motivate and support a team, and learn the difference between intelligence and emotional intelligence.
  • Delivering Results – Organizational and operational skills, implementation plan elements, and the importance of accountability are all essential components that will assist leaders in achieving their desired results.

Each topic serves as a Learning Project that will help participants establish key leadership dimensions, create new ideas, and think strategically. For every Learning Project, participants will analyze a case study or use their own employment history as the backdrop to examine essential learning questions.   

A certificate is awarded upon completion of the five required Learning Projects with a grade of “C” or better. Participants will have 90 days from the date of enrollment to submit a Learning Project for evaluation; all requirements must be completed within five years after the student enrolls in his/her first Learning Project.

About UC Irvine Extension: University of California, Irvine Extension is the continuing education arm of UC Irvine, serving nearly 40,000 students globally and offering more than 3,200 classes annually on the UC Irvine campus, online and at employer sites throughout California and worldwide. Since 1962, UC Irvine Extension has served Orange County with programs and classes to help adult learners reach their career advancement and personal enrichment goals, and remains dedicated to providing broad access to the resources of the University for the benefit of the public, both through University Extension certificate and specialized studies programs and a broad range of free and open educational resources including UC Irvine OpenCourseWare.  About the University of California, Irvine: Founded in 1965, UC Irvine is a top-ranked university dedicated to research, scholarship and community service. Led by Chancellor Michael Drake since 2005, UC Irvine is among the most dynamic campuses in the University of California system, with nearly 28,000 undergraduate and graduate students, 1,100 faculty and 9,000 staff. Orange County’s largest employer, UC Irvine contributes an annual economic impact of $4.2 billion. For more UC Irvine news, visit today.uci.edu.
